A weeks-long rally in space-related stocks came to an abrupt halt on Friday following the explosion of a Blue Origin rocket. The incident served as a sharp reminder of the inherent operational and technological risks that accompany the industry's potential for growth and investor enthusiasm.

The space sector’s recent upward momentum faced a sudden reversal on Friday after an explosive failure during a Blue Origin rocket launch. The event, which occurred at Blue Origin’s test facility, underscored the technical challenges that remain prevalent in the aerospace industry, even among well-established private players. According to sources, the rocket disintegrated shortly after liftoff, with no reported injuries or damage to ground infrastructure. Prior to the incident, space-related stocks had enjoyed a sustained rally over several weeks, buoyed by positive sentiment around commercial space ventures, government contracts, and technological advancements. The Blue Origin explosion, however, introduced a note of caution, prompting a broad sell-off in the sector. Shares of publicly traded companies with ties to space exploration and satellite services declined notably in Friday’s trading session, as investors reassessed the risk-reward profile of the industry. The Blue Origin explosion may reinforce investor wariness regarding the timeline and reliability of commercial space projects. While the industry has seen significant capital inflows and high-profile successes, such as recent crewed missions and satellite deployments, incidents like this highlight the experimental nature of rocket technology and the potential for costly delays. From a market perspective, the sell-off suggests that near-term investor sentiment could be fragile, especially if further technical investigations reveal systemic issues. The rally preceding the explosion may have been partially driven by speculative trading, and the correction could represent a recalibration of expectations. Companies with exposure to Blue Origin’s supply chain or those competing directly with the firm might experience heightened scrutiny from analysts and shareholders. For those with holdings in space-related equities, the event may prompt a review of portfolio exposure to early-stage or high-risk companies in the sector. The broader space industry, however, is unlikely to be derailed by a single mishap; federal oversight bodies typically conduct thorough investigations, and long-term contracts with agencies like NASA provide a degree of stability. Still, the sector’s risk profile remains elevated compared to more mature industries. Investors would likely benefit from diversification across a range of space subsectors—such as satellite communications, launch services, and defense-related aerospace—rather than concentrating on any single company. The market’s response to the Blue Origin explosion may offer a cautionary signal about the disconnect between speculative rallies and operational realities. Future developments from the investigation will be closely watched for their potential impact on industry regulations, insurance costs, and investor confidence.
